About Kyle
The MacPherson's real estate sales division is led by the president of the company, Kyle Moore. An 18-year veteran of the business and the great grandson of the Founder of MacPherson’s, Kyle has led the company in sales since 2007. His unique approach to handling each transaction based upon his client’s goals has led to many customers changing their opinion of what an agent CAN do and how their experiences in the past failed to live up to the amazing service provided by Kyle and MacPherson’s Real Estate.
In the Summer of 2012, a long-time neighbor had to enter an assisted living situation and could not pack and prepare her Haller Lake cottage for sale. Kyle led a group of workers who emptied, donated, and cleaned out the entire home in a week, cleaned and landscaped the yard and got the home listed and sold within a month of the start of the project. It was a task that others in the industry would never have even attempted to take on, but Kyle was ready and willing to work for his clients’ needs.
In need of help relocating from Virginia in the Spring of 2016, a new buyer to the area relied heavily on Kyle’s knowledge of location and how to find a perfect place to be a hiker in the city. After 3 months of previewing, sending listings and listening to the right fit, he found the perfect home to match the vision of what she was looking for, on the side of Carkeek Park.
For an investor from Alaska whose daughter was attending Seattle U, in January of 2015 Kyle creatively found a way to turn a 3 bed home into a 4 bedroom home with the help of his long established home flipping crew, to create a cash flow opportunity and a safe place for the investors to put their daughter in, while her roommates covered her room and board. While waiting for the semester to start, he put them in contact with a vacation home management team and they made more money over the summer renting their newly transformed four-bedroom home.
